US Stock Markets Rally Amid Trump’s Latest Remarks on Fed’s Powell, China

U.S. stocks surged on April 23, as President Donald Trump clarified his stance on Federal Reserve Chair Jerome Powell and China tariffs.
The Dow Jones Industrial Average, an index of blue-chip stocks, advanced by more than 900 points, or more than 2 percent.
The broader S&P 500 Index jumped more than 100 points, or 2.5 percent. The tech-heavy Nasdaq Composite Index soared by close to 600 points, or 3.6 percent.
Following the weeks-long tariff-driven decline in the financial markets, Wall Street is looking to build on its April 22 gains after all three leading benchmark averages climbed nearly 3 percent.
Despite Trump’s recent criticisms of the central bank chief, the president confirmed to reporters at the Oval Office on April 22 that he has “no intention” of firing Powell before his term expires in May 2026….
